Kanye West’s YZY Token Crash: $3B Hype Ends in Pain for Retail Investors

Kanye West’s YZY token soared to a $3B valuation before plunging more than 90% within hours. Insiders walked away with $24M while retail investors suffered steep losses in another celebrity-driven crypto meltdown.

Ripple-SEC File Final Motion Ahead of June 16 Deadline

Ripple and the SEC have filed a joint motion proposing a $102.6 million settlement to end their long-running legal battle. Judge Torres is expected to rule by June 16, potentially closing one of crypto’s most closely watched enforcement cases.
